| Description of the problem | My steering wheel has become increasingly loose and shaky over the past months when driving or stationary. There is a very distinct (and getting worse over time) "clicking" or "knocking" sound when i back up and turn my wheel either way. I was told by my mechanic that something is wrong with my steering gear box/shaft sector and possibly some of my axles. He told me this was dangerous, and that the recall campaign number 097 should cover me. However, i was told by hyundai that my specific car does not fall under this recall, even though i my car has the exact symptoms of the recall. I was also told that because of recent recalls, my warranty would be extended. However, hyundai has now told me that my warranty extension only covers the sole engine, and not the axles though they are part of and covered by the initial engine warranty. Hyundai has told me there are "kits" to fix these problems, but i have to pay over $1000 for the kits to fix, even though these were faulty parts by hyundai. The hyundai service manager i spoke with told me flat out that my car had faulty parts, but that the kits could fix them. I asked him whose fault it was that they were faulty, and he said that all car companies deal with this and it wasn't because of my driving. But even still so, i have to be the one to pay for hyundai's faulty parts and non-existent recall help.
